Understanding Coolant Leaks: A Comprehensive Overview

Coolant leaks are a prevalent issue in automotive maintenance, with varying degrees of severity and potential consequences. Understanding the underlying causes, common symptoms, and the potential impact on vehicle performance is crucial for effective diagnosis and repair. Here’s a comprehensive look at coolant leaks:

Common Causes: - Wear and Tear: Aging hoses, clamps, and seals can deteriorate over time, leading to leaks. - Corrosion: Rust and corrosion can compromise the integrity of coolant system components. - Physical Damage: Accidents, impacts, or even debris can damage the radiator, hoses, or other parts. - Thermal Stress: Extreme temperature fluctuations can cause cracks or weaknesses in the system.

Symptoms and Detection: - Visible Leaks: A puddle of coolant beneath the vehicle is often the first sign. - Low Coolant Levels: Regularly topping up coolant may indicate a leak. - Overheating: Inadequate coolant can lead to engine overheating and potential damage. - Sweet Odor: A sweet smell, often described as similar to syrup, may indicate a coolant leak. - Dashboard Warning Lights: Some vehicles may display specific coolant-related warnings.

Impact on Vehicle Performance: - Engine Damage: Prolonged leaks can cause severe engine overheating, leading to costly repairs or even engine failure. - Fuel Efficiency: An overheated engine may burn more fuel, impacting fuel efficiency and increasing costs. - Vehicle Lifespan: Regular and timely repairs can extend the life of the vehicle’s cooling system and overall performance.

Prevention and Maintenance: - Regularly inspect the coolant system for visible signs of wear or damage. - Use high-quality coolant and maintain proper coolant levels. - Consider professional inspections, especially after accidents or major repairs. - Address small leaks promptly to prevent larger, more costly issues.

Diagnosing Coolant Leaks: A Step-by-Step Guide

Diagnosing a coolant leak can be a complex process, but with a systematic approach, vehicle owners and mechanics can pinpoint the issue efficiently. Here’s a detailed guide to diagnosing coolant leaks:

Step 1: Visual Inspection: - Park on a Level Surface: Ensure the vehicle is parked on a flat surface to accurately assess any leaks. - Check Under the Vehicle: Look for any signs of coolant leakage, including puddles or stains. - Inspect the Engine Bay: Check for leaks around the radiator, hoses, and other components.

Step 2: Pressure Testing: - Use a Pressure Tester: This tool can help identify leaks by pressurizing the cooling system and observing any changes. - Monitor for Leaks: Listen for hissing sounds and watch for bubbles, which may indicate a leak.

Step 3: Dye Testing: - Add Dye to the Coolant: Special dyes can be added to the coolant, making leaks more visible. - Inspect with a Black Light: Use a black light to illuminate any leaks, which will glow under UV light.

Step 4: Component Testing: - Test Radiator Hoses: Squeeze hoses to check for softness or brittleness, which may indicate a leak. - Inspect Clamps and Seals: Look for any signs of corrosion or damage. - Check the Radiator: Look for cracks, corrosion, or damage to the radiator itself.

Step 5: Professional Diagnosis: - Seek Expert Advice: If the leak is not readily apparent, consult a professional mechanic for a thorough inspection.

Repairing Coolant Leaks: Strategies and Costs

Coolant leak repairs can vary significantly in complexity and cost, depending on the source of the leak and the specific vehicle model. Here’s an in-depth look at the repair process and associated costs:

Repair Strategies: - Hose Replacement: Hoses are a common source of leaks. Replacement typically involves disconnecting and reconnecting the old and new hoses, ensuring a proper fit and secure connections. - Seal Replacement: Seals and gaskets can wear out over time, leading to leaks. Replacing these components often requires careful disassembly and reassembly to ensure a proper seal. - Radiator Repair: Radiators can develop leaks due to corrosion or damage. Repairs may involve patching or, in severe cases, radiator replacement. - Water Pump Replacement: A faulty water pump can cause coolant leaks. Replacement involves removing the old pump and installing a new one, ensuring proper alignment and fastening.

Average Repair Costs: - Hose Replacement: 50 to 200, depending on the vehicle model and the number of hoses involved. - Seal Replacement: 100 to 300, depending on the complexity of the seal and the vehicle’s make and model. - Radiator Repair: Patching a radiator can cost 100 to 300, while a full radiator replacement may range from 400 to 1,000 or more. - Water Pump Replacement: 300 to 800, including parts and labor.

Factors Influencing Costs: - Vehicle Make and Model: Certain vehicles may have more complex cooling systems or require specialized parts, increasing repair costs. - Labor Costs: The complexity of the repair and the required labor hours can significantly impact the overall cost. - Part Availability: Sourcing rare or specialized parts may incur additional costs and delays. - Diagnostic Fees: Some shops charge a fee for diagnosing the issue, which can be separate from the repair costs.

DIY Considerations: - Some coolant leak repairs, such as hose replacement, can be tackled by experienced DIYers. However, more complex repairs, like radiator or water pump replacement, are best left to professionals due to the risk of further damage or improper installation.

Coolant leak repairs can range from relatively affordable to quite costly, depending on the issue’s complexity and the specific vehicle. Preventive Measures: Extending the Life of Your Cooling System

Preventive maintenance is key to avoiding costly coolant leak repairs and ensuring the longevity of your vehicle’s cooling system. Here’s a comprehensive guide to keeping your cooling system in top shape:

Regular Maintenance: - Check Coolant Levels: Regularly inspect the coolant reservoir and ensure the coolant is at the appropriate level. - Top Up with the Right Coolant: Use the recommended coolant type and maintain a 5050 mix with distilled water. - Replace Coolant Regularly: Follow the vehicle manufacturer’s recommendations for coolant replacement intervals. - Inspect Hoses and Clamps: Check for any signs of wear, cracks, or leaks. Replace hoses every 4-7 years as a preventive measure.

Advanced Maintenance Techniques: - Pressure Testing: Use a pressure tester to identify potential leaks or weaknesses in the system. - Dye Testing: Add dye to the coolant and use a black light to detect even the smallest leaks. - Radiator Flush: Periodically flush the radiator to remove debris and buildup that can lead to corrosion.

Professional Inspections: - Annual Inspections: Consider having a professional mechanic inspect your cooling system annually or every 15,000 miles. - Post-Accident Checks: After any accident or major repair, have the cooling system inspected to ensure there are no hidden leaks or damage.

Avoid Overheating: - Keep an Eye on the Temperature Gauge: Monitor your vehicle’s temperature to prevent overheating, which can lead to coolant system damage. - Address Overheating Issues Promptly: If your vehicle overheats, have it inspected immediately to prevent further damage.

Use High-Quality Coolant: - Invest in a high-quality coolant that suits your vehicle’s make and model. Cheaper coolants may not provide adequate protection and can lead to more frequent leaks.

What are some signs that a coolant leak is causing engine damage?

+

Signs of engine damage due to a coolant leak include persistent overheating, white smoke from the exhaust, a sweet smell in the cabin, or visible damage to the engine block.
